What companies run services between South Shields, England and Manchester Piccadilly Station, England?

TransPennine Express operates a train from Newcastle to Manchester Piccadilly every 4 hours. Tickets cost £50–90 and the journey takes 2h 23m. Alternatively, National Express operates a bus from Interchange to Manchester Central Coach Station every 3 hours. Tickets cost £25–60 and the journey takes 3h 50m.
